What Business Location Is Right For You?

Selecting a Business Location

There are many different locations you can have for your business, and choosing the right one will go a long way in determining how successful your business will be. Your location has to suit you and your business, while at the same time not costing you too much. So, what type of location is going to be best for you? Here is a list of different business location types, and what they can offer you.

  1. Retail: If you are selling retail products, then allowing customers to reach you is of paramount importance. You can have your retail location in a wide variety of places including a mall (enclosed or strip), shopping centre, shopping district or multi-use facilities. You can reach many customers this way without having to advertise, but the rent can be quite high.
  2. Home: If you can, a home-based business location is the best. Not only do you not have to pay rent for the location, but also you can write off part of your rent/mortgage because you are using a portion of your home for your business. You can use a spare bedroom, garage, kitchen table, attic or anywhere that suits you in your home. The only problem is that the growth of your business is limited at times, and you will have to manage your home life with your business life.
  3. Commercial: If retail is not enough, a commercial location may be the best. You get office space, parking and more in business parks and office buildings. You can be downtown, on the outskirts of town, or in a suburban area. One of the great things about a commercial space is it looks very professional with a place for a receptionist, offices for employees and more. The only downside is that it can be very expensive and that can cut into your bottom line when you are just starting out.
  4. Mobile: Rather than have a fixed location, you can work directly out of your vehicle, going to your customers rather than having your customers come to you. You can write off part of your car payment and the gas, while not paying any rent for your business location. It is a great option if you are just starting out and can work in a mobile environment.
  5. Industrial: If you have a business in an industrial sector, then having industrial space is very important. You typically will get large spaces, yards and more, which allows you to showcase what you are selling, or to serve as a distribution centre if that is what your business is in. The type of industry you are in will determine if you are in a light, medium, or heavy industrial area of the city.

Location, location, location is what they say about business and if you don’t choose the right location, you may not have a successful business. That is why you must do what you can to choose the right business location type.

American Express Platinum: 3 Things You Will Love & Hate

Amex Platinum

The American Express Platinum credit card provides various perks and features. Today, I will talk about some you will like and some you won’t.

3 Things You Will Love

Lounge Access – provides unlimited lounge access through various lounge programs such as Plaza Premium Lounge, Priority Pass, Delta Sky Club, and Amex Centurion Lounge, etc. Some of these will even provide free access for additional company. By far this is one of the most sought-after perks for Amex Platinum.

Upgrades Elite Status for Hotel Loyalty Programs – The second thing you will love is the upgraded elite status you will be receiving without staying a night at some of the best hotel chains. In general, you would normally have to stay 20 or more nights to achieve it. Some of these hotels are Club Carlson, Hilton Honors, SPG or Marriott. Having elite status comes with various perks from these hotels.

Full Insurance Coverage – Another thing you will love is the free insurance coverage that comes with this card. This includes out of country medical insurance, trip cancellation insurance, trip interruption insurance, and many more. The good thing about these insurances is that the provider is a reputable one with a good track record, unlike some other credit cards where the providers make it difficult to receive insurance when you file claims.

Now, let’s look at some of the features you will not love.

Hefty Annual Fee – Paying $699 per year is a hefty fee and many times higher that most other premium credit cards in Canada, where the annual fee ranges from $99 to $165.

Poor Rewards Earning – Many of you will not like receiving only flat 1.25 points per dollar after paying the $699 annual fee. Even the American Express Gold credit card that only charges a $150 annual fee has accelerated categories where you earn 2 points per dollar.

Limited Transfer Partners – Points provide the best value when you transfer them to airline partners and Amex provides very limited partners to which you can transfer. Some of these partners are Aeroplan, Avios, SPG, Hilton Honors, etc.

| How To Know Your Business Will Be A Success |

Tips For A Successful Business

Many new businesses fail within their first two years. Either the person running them is not working hard enough at being an entrepreneur, or the business is just in the wrong market, or has too much competition around it. This can cause a lot of people to worry about starting a business because they do not know if it is going to be successful or not. So, how do you know if your business is going to be successful? How do you ensure that when the time comes to start a business as an entrepreneur, that the business will be successful and profitable for years to come?

The problem is that there really is no way to know. You can’t say for certain that your business will be successful because there are too many variables. The man who created the pet rock may not have thought his business would be successful but it made him millions. On that same note, many who thought their dot-com business would be successful found that the opposite was going to be true.

The first thing you need to look at is your passion for what you are doing. Do you love what you do? Do you want to succeed at it? If you are not ready to put in the long hours needed, then maybe you should look elsewhere for a business because you must love what you do in order to succeed.

What is the competition like in your area? There is a misconception that no competition means that there is a guaranteed chance of success. For example, if there is no air conditioning supplier competition where you are and you live in the Arctic, well that does not mean you are going to sell air conditioners. It means there is no market for it. You should have a bit of competition, but not too much and you should be able to offer your customers something different from other competitors.

How much money do you need to start your business? If you can start the business out of your home with minimal investment, then you will have a higher chance of success. The reason for this is that the less you pay initially, the less in debt you are and the less you have to make to earn a profit. However, if you have to borrow $500,000 to start your business, well even if your business is not making money, you have to make payments on your loan. That may cause you to fall behind in your payments, which will then cause your business to suffer. It is just not the best idea to borrow large amounts of money unless you know your business is going to be successful.

Sometimes you just have to take the risk and hope your business will be successful. That is what being an entrepreneur is all about, risk and adventure, but that does not mean you should just go into business without thinking about it first. Planning ahead can make things easier for you down the road.
